Materials Used in Outdoor Screen Enclosures
Aluminum Screen Enclosures
Aluminum outdoor screen enclosures are a popular choice due to their durability and low maintenance requirements. Aluminum frames are highly resistant to rust and can withstand the elements, making them ideal for outdoor installations. Additionally, aluminum screen enclosures offer excellent visibility and are available in different finishes, allowing you to match your outdoor aesthetics effortlessly.
Vinyl Screen Enclosures
Vinyl outdoor screen enclosures are another viable option, known for their affordability and ease of installation. Vinyl frames are lightweight, yet sturdy, and can withstand various weather conditions. They require minimal maintenance and are resistant to rot, corrosion, and fading. Vinyl screen enclosures offer versatility in design and are available in various colors to complement your property’s exterior.
Wood Screen Enclosures
For those seeking a more natural and rustic look, wood screen enclosures are an appealing option. Wood offers warmth and blends seamlessly with outdoor surroundings. While wood screen enclosures require more maintenance compared to other materials, regular staining and sealing can help prolong their lifespan. Additionally, wood enclosures provide excellent privacy and can be customized to suit your specific design preferences.
Installation Process of Outdoor Screen Enclosures
Pre-Installation Considerations
Prior to installing an outdoor screen enclosure, it is essential to consider a few key factors. Assess the layout, size, and shape of the area you wish to enclose. Take into account any existing structures or landscaping features that could impact the installation process. Furthermore, check local building codes and regulations to ensure compliance and obtain any necessary permits. Finally, establish a budget and consult with professionals to determine the most suitable enclosure design and material for your needs.
Step-by-Step Installation Guide
While the specifics of the installation process may vary depending on the type and size of the enclosure, the following general steps provide an overview:
- Prepare the area by clearing any obstructions and ensuring a level foundation.
- Measure and mark the placement of the enclosure, ensuring proper alignment.
- Install the main frame, following manufacturer instructions and using appropriate tools.
- Secure the screen panels, ensuring a tight and secure fit.
- Check for any gaps or openings, making necessary adjustments to ensure proper closure.
- Add any additional features, such as doors, windows, or ventilation systems, as desired.
- Perform a thorough inspection to ensure the installation is sturdy and meets your requirements.
Maintenance and Care for Your Screen Enclosure
Regular Cleaning Tips
To keep your outdoor screen enclosure in optimal condition, regular cleaning is essential. Here are a few tips to help you maintain its cleanliness:
- Remove any loose debris, such as leaves or twigs, from the screens and frames.
- Gently wash the screens using mild soap or a specialized outdoor screen cleaner.
- Rinse thoroughly with water, ensuring all cleaning residues are removed.
- Dry the screens and frames with a clean, soft cloth to prevent water spots or streaks.
- Regularly inspect the screens for any tears or damage, repairing them promptly to prevent further issues.
Repair and Replacement Advice
Over time, certain components of your outdoor screen enclosure may require repair or replacement. If you notice any tears or holes in the screen panels, patch them using appropriate repair kits or consult professional screen repair services. Additionally, if the frames show signs of corrosion or damage, seek expert advice to determine whether repairs are possible or if replacement parts are needed. Regular inspections and timely maintenance can help extend the lifespan of your screen enclosure and ensure its continued functionality.
